    The Screen Actors Guild union (SAG-AFTRA) filed an unfair labor practice charge against Epic Games and Fortnite signatory company, Llama Productions, over the use of AI for Darth Vader's voice in Fortnite.

    As part of the ongoing Chapter 6 Season 3 in Fortnite, players can add Darth Vader as an NPC squad mate. While a part of your crew, NPC Darth Vader will utilize an AI version of James Earl Jones' voice to verbally converse with the team. Initially, the AI was seemingly untethered, which allowed players to get Vader so say everything from racial slurs, homophobic slurs, racial stereotypes, swears, and more. Developers were somewhat quick to fix this gross oversight and is, somehow, not the only issue that came about from AI Darth Vader.

    SAG-AFTRA mostly takes issue with the fact that neither Epic Games nor Llama Productions provided the union with notice of their intent to use the AI voice nor did they bargain with SAG-AFTRA for appropriate terms. The union, which represents over 160,000 actors and artists, issued the following public statement.

    We celebrate the right of our members and their estates to control the use of their digital replicas and welcome the use of new technologies to allow new generations to share in the enjoyment of those legacies and renowned roles. However, we must protect our right to bargain terms and conditions around uses of voice that replace the work of our members, including those who previously did the work of matching Darth Vader's iconic rhythm and tone in video games.

    Fortnite's signatory company, Llama Productions, chose to replace the work of human performers with A.I. technology. Unfortunately, they did so without providing any notice of their intent to do this and without bargaining with us over appropriate terms. As such, we have filed an unfair labor practice charge with the NLRB against Llama Productions.​
    If you would like to read the full filing for the unfair labor practice charge, you can do so via the SAG-AFTRA website (direct link to PDF). So far, neither Epic Games nor Llama Productions have issued any sort of a public response to the charge.
